I caught myself buying the same items twice and forgetting that I already had it. That’s when I decided to make a change. Donated or just gave away about half of my wardrobe and I feel much better. In the process I realized that I almost always wore the same items anyway and most of my purchases would just sit in the closet. I think great marketing and the desire to belong and be part of the fashionable and trendy community fueled my need to make unnecessary purchases. I still enjoy fashion and appreciate clothes and sneakers without the need to buy everything I see. Thank you for the video James. 👍🏻

A big changer for me was knowing my measurements. I know buy more confidently online and invest in better fitting pieces.
Another one was selling my clothes online. I have a rule of only buying one item, after selling another one that I don't use.
